Coaching and mentoring are both valuable tools for personal and professional development, but they have distinct differences in the context of the Qcf Level 4 Certificate in Coaching and Mentoring to Build Relationships qualification. Let's explore the main differences between coaching and mentoring in this qualification:
Coaching is a structured process that focuses on specific goals and objectives. It is typically short-term and task-oriented, with the aim of improving performance and achieving desired outcomes. In the Qcf Level 4 Certificate in Coaching and Mentoring to Build Relationships qualification, coaching is often used to develop specific skills or address specific challenges in a professional setting.
Coaching | Mentoring |
---|---|
Short-term | Long-term |
Task-oriented | Relationship-oriented |
Focused on specific goals | Focused on overall development |
Mentoring, on the other hand, is a more long-term and relationship-oriented process. It involves a mentor who shares their knowledge, experience, and wisdom with a mentee to help them grow and develop personally and professionally. In the Qcf Level 4 Certificate in Coaching and Mentoring to Build Relationships qualification, mentoring is often used to provide guidance, support, and advice to individuals seeking to advance their careers or navigate challenging situations.
While coaching and mentoring share some similarities, such as the goal of supporting individual growth and development, they differ in their focus, duration, and approach. In the Qcf Level 4 Certificate in Coaching and Mentoring to Build Relationships qualification, both coaching and mentoring play important roles in building strong relationships and fostering personal and professional growth.
By understanding the main differences between coaching and mentoring in this qualification, individuals can choose the most appropriate approach to meet their specific needs and goals.
